Analysis

Australia recorded 133 for mean hemoglobin level of women of reproductive age in 2019. That is the highest value across all 20 years on record.

The figure is unchanged over ten years.

Over the whole period, mean hemoglobin level of women of reproductive age in Australia peaked at 133 in 2000 and was at its lowest, 133, in 2000.

That places Australia 4th out of 194 countries with data for 2019, putting it in the top 10%.

Australia compared with similar countries

  • Australia's 133 is above the median for high income countries, which is 131, 1.0× the median. (63 countries reporting)
  • Australia's 133 is above the median for East Asia & Pacific, which is 126, 1.1× the median. (30 countries reporting)
